AT THE HEART OF THE ROAD TRANSPORT INDUSTRY.

Call our Sales Team on 0208 912 2120

11th January 1927, Page 46
11th January 1927
Page 46
Page 46, 11th January 1927
Close

Developing The Bus Parking Station.

Local Authorities are Recognizing the Need for the Provision of Suitable Bus Stations Conducted Under Reasonable Regulations. W ITH the great expansion of public passenger......